Premiere Elements can edit 4k with Ryzen ?

"Https://www.adobe.com/products/premiere-elements/tech-specs.html" says "Intel Core i7 and 16GB RAM required for XAVC-S (4K editing)". But is it OK with "AMD Ryzen 7 3700X"? "Https://helpx.adobe.com/premiere-pro/system-requirements.html" says that the equivalent AMD is OK. I feel like I can do it. How is it actually?

PassMark's benchmark numbers are invaluable when comparing processors.

 

In my books I recommend a processor that rates at least a 10,000 for editing 4K video. Your processor rates a 22,731 so you'll be just fine!
